1 - set a static ip to your pc in your LAN See here 2 - Disable firewall on pc or allow remote desktop port 3389 See here 3 - Set password to your aco**** on your pc and make it member of Administrator See here 4- Go to your router's management page and forward remote desktop port to your computer's new static ip See here 5 - Enambe remote desktop on your pc See here 6 - Start Rdesktop 1.7 package on your N900 and type your computers internet ip you can get it from a site like whatismyip.org For easy use see if your router supports http://www.dyndns.com/ . If it does just open a free account and you won't need to remember your pc's ip all the time
